Heim > Artikel > Backend-Entwicklung > PHP prüft, ob der öffentliche Schlüssel verfügbar ist
So verwenden Sie den öffentlichen RSA-Schlüssel für die Remote-Anmeldeüberprüfung über ssh
1. Generieren Sie den Schlüssel auf dem lokalen Computer
$ssh-keygen -t rsa
generiert die zweite Version des Schlüssels basierend auf dem SSH-Protokoll. Wenn Sie noch rsa1 verwenden, ist es Zeit für ein Upgrade.
2. Kopieren Sie die generierte öffentliche Schlüsseldatei id_rsa.pub auf den Remote-Server
$scp id_rsa.pub bsduser@192.168.1.188:mykey.pub
3. Melden Sie sich mit dem Passwort am Remote-Server an
$ssh 192.168.1.188 -l bsduserBeachten Sie hier, dass es sich nicht um cp, sondern um cat; nicht um „>>“ handelt:
%cat mykey.pub >> $HOME/.ssh/authorized_keys
4. Starten Sie sshd neu ein umständliches und leicht durchsickerndes Passwort. Voraussetzung ist jedoch, dass Sie Ihre wichtigen Dateiinformationen schützen müssen.
Der obige Inhalt dient nur als Referenz!
Empfohlenes Tutorial: PHP-Video-Tutorial
Das obige ist der detaillierte Inhalt vonPHP prüft, ob der öffentliche Schlüssel verfügbar ist. Für weitere Informationen folgen Sie bitte anderen verwandten Artikeln auf der PHP chinesischen Website!